Job Title:  Executive Producer - Atlanta Radio

 

Position Overview

Cox Media Group (CMG) is looking for an Executive Producer for Atlanta Radio WSB-FM. We’re seeking talented, enthusiastic, motivated, and goal-oriented individuals who are self-starters and excel in a fast-paced work environment. We cover breaking news and weather, all with a heart for the community both on-air and online.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

• Monitor on-air programming for quality, timing, and compliance with FCC regulations.

• Operate broadcast console and studio equipment during live and pre-recorded shows

• Oversee all training and scheduling of Board Ops

• Coordinate with talent, producers, and traffic teams to ensure smooth transitions and accurate commercial placement.

• Troubleshoot technical issues in real time and escalate as needed.

• Record, edit, and load audio content for playback using automation systems.

• Maintain logs and documentation for regulatory and internal compliance.

• Support remote broadcasts and live events as needed.

• Monitors listener emails, inquiries and responses related to shows

• Assist the management team with planning of future projects, elections, and other special events. Must be assertive with breaking news and weather coverage.

About Cox Media Group 
CMG Media Corporation (d/b/a Cox Media Group) is an industry-leading media company with unparalleled brands, award-winning content, and exceptional team members. CMG provides valuable local and national journalism and entertainment content to the people and communities it serves. The company's businesses encompass 14 high-quality, market-leading television brands in 9 markets; 45 top-performing radio stations delivering multiple genres of content in 9 markets; and numerous streaming and digital platforms. CMG's TV portfolio includes multiple primary affiliates of ABC, CBS, FOX, NBC, Telemundo and MyNetworkTV, as well as several valuable news and independent stations.
